Winter sucks. Unless you live in Southern California, you’ve probably experience some sort of cold and foul weather this weekend. It sucks. To help get away from it all, I flew across the country to Los Angeles to spend a weekend in a 2016 Mustang GT. With 435 horsepower and a manual transmission, we headed up to the canyons for fun and adventure. It sure beats being snowed-in at home!

2016 Ford Mustang GT California Adventure Gallery_11

You can read my full writeup of the Mustang here, but it’s safe to say the new Mustang is the best Mustang yet. The most notable improvement really is the independent rear suspension. There are bumps on the canyon roads that would’ve knocked the previous Mustang out of line, but the new one took everything in stride.

2016 Ford Mustang GT California Adventure Gallery_4

But, when you get a bunch of car guys together with a V8-powered, rear-wheel drive, American-built muscle car, hijinks are sure to ensue. The S550 Mustang is an easy car to get the back end loose on. It’s even easier than the more-powerful Camaro SS I recently was in. Plus, the Mustang sounds great and the electronic nannies have a full off button.

Life, my friends, is good. Except now I’m back in the cold, snowy hell of the midwest. Oh well.
